The Boeing Additive Manufacturing (BAM) organization is seeking a high performing
Mechanical System Design and Analysis Engineer (Associate or Mid-Level)
in
El Segundo, CA
to design, analyze and provide oversight to the development and flight production of additively manufactured system components within the Boeing Auburn fabrication center. This candidate will be a part of a high-performing engineering team that is immersed in development and high Non-Recurring projects. The engineer will work closely with business units and the BAM Auburn fabrication team to develop and deliver flight components including design, analysis, and test. Emphasis would be on the development, design, analysis, test, and production of the additive process for high IP applications. Position Responsibilities: Level 2: Support development and qualification of complex additive manufactured system components Support the development and documentation of mechanical and vibration environments to establish the system design Support activities to validate and verify mechanical systems requirements Develop, integrate and document structural requirements to establish the additive system design Coordinate with other engineering groups to establish the product's environmental requirements Perform product design and verify structural integrity by using analytical methods, finite element models/simulations and other analysis tools throughout the product lifecycle to develop the structural environment, characteristics and performance Support additive development, qualification testing and production activities and direct the supplier to optimize integration and achieve program goals Develop test plans and configurations, support test execution and analyzes/reports test results to validate and verify systems and components meet requirements and specifications Define and document certification and test results to substantiate for customers and regulatory agencies that requirements are satisfied Level 3: Lead development and qualification of complex additive manufactured system components Lead & provide technical quality review of the development and documentation of mechanical and vibration environments to establish the system design Lead activities to validate and verify mechanical systems requirements Develop, integrate and document structural requirements to establish the additive system design Coordinate with other engineering groups to establish the product's environmental requirements Guide product design and verify structural integrity by using analytical methods, finite element models/simulations and other analysis tools throughout the product lifecycle to develop the structural environment, characteristics and performance Manage additive development, qualification testing and production activities and direct the supplier to optimize integration and achieve program goals Develop test plans and configurations, support test execution and analyzes/reports test results to validate and verify systems and components meet requirements and specifications Define and document certification and test results to substantiate for customers and regulatory agencies that requirements are satisfied Basic Qualifications (Required Skills/Experience): Bachelor of Science degree in Engineering, Engineering Technology (including Manufacturing Technology), Computer Science, Data Science, Mathematics, Physics, Chemistry Experience with flight additive manufacturing implementation Experience with integrated design & analysis (e.g. ProE/CREO or Unigraphics NX) Experience with Geometric Dimensioning and Tolerancing (GD&T) Experience in vibration and analysis and test principles Knowledge or experience using NASTRAN and PATRAN finite element modeling software Fracture mechanics analysis using NASGRO and/or AFGROW Preferred Qualifications (Desired Skills/Experience): Experience with decomposing requirements and development of vehicle architectures. Experience with spacecraft, launch vehicle, vertical lift and other flight vehicle systems Experience in development, build and test of vehicle system components. Experience with requirement verification methods and artifacts. Bachelor or Masters (preferred) Degree in Mechanical, Structural, or Aerospace Engineering Boeing is a Drug Free Workplace where post offer applicants and employees are subject to testing for marijuana, cocaine, opioids, amphetamines, PCP, and alcohol when criteria is met as outlined in our policies.
